Summary/Abstract: This article presents basic guidelines that may be a starting point in the Christian formation of adults. These guidelines are formulated based on experience and theoretical knowledge of the author, who has been working in the Prague Archdiocese in the area of adult pastoral care for a long time. The pastoral practice of the Church in the Czech Republic is complex. The changes taking place in this society are of a multidirectional transformation of religiosity under the influence of strong trends of secularism. In addition, there are many prejudices and stereotypes towards the Church. For this reason, the methodological work of the Church to overcome stereotypes and prejudices is the logical and most important point of guidance. The pastoral practice of the Church demands that attention be paid to ad intra formation, i.e. ongoing formation of adult Christians, especially those involved in the process of adult catechesis, because true and fruitful evangelisation only makes sense if the Church itself is first evangelised and renewed. Evangelisation in a broad sense can be understood as the whole activity of the Church, which is why the third point discussed is formation ad extra.
